    3dmark 11 says my xps 15 is running my intel graphics instead of 525m

    Discussion in 'Dell XPS and Studio XPS' started by maze11, Jan 30, 2012.

    Any ideas? The bottom tray says 3dmark is using my nvidia under the NVIDIA GPU activity. But I'm getting a 3dmark graphics score of 800.

    I have experienced The same problem with my , after i changed the settings in the nvidia control panel ( i wanted to force ( or make sure )that the 3d mark to only use the nvidia card ) funnyli enough the system started to use the hd3000 gpu , i have set everything back to the original settings ( global settings - auto select ) and everything works as it should again - fast .
